when doing a complet conversion (ST204 to ST205), the direction parts (rack-and-pinion, sway bar, spindles etc) fits only if you go RHD (since they are only available from the RHD ST205)... but what if you take them from a ST185 LHD (canadian GT-Four), would it fit to go AWD and stay LHD? And by fit I mean without any major modifications or cutting & welding...
To sum up: converting a ST204.... swap a ST205 engine + tranny with AWD rear and ST185 direction parts on the front to stay LHD?
Of course you could use the front of a LHD ST205, but try to find one!!!! OR maybe ordering brand new parts from a dealer? But geez, trying to find a Toyota dealer that can hook me up with LHD ST205 would be hard as ****!
